You should have B+ at the alternator. I would guess you have a blown fusible link. I think it is around the battery cable fuse box area. It should be a short wire with a connector at each end. I have replaced them on Nissan trucks and they are tied along the harness. I think it should be a 100 amp part number 9130446320. Check with your CAT dealer for the correct part.
